Join us as a Third-Party Risk Analyst

  • You’ll support, develop and deliver innovative Third-Party Risk Management (TPRM) and supply chain solutions that give us a competitive advantage, improves the customer experience and aligns with the bank’s cost and risk appetite expectations
  • You’ll also support and implement joined-up, global TPRM and supply chain solutions and processes across the bank in accordance with the frameworks and Risk Standard
  • This is a great opportunity where you’ll be building strong networks across the industry and other external organisations, including competitors, and developing deep insights and analysis that can be brought back in and utilised within the bank
  • We're offering this role at associate level
What you'll do

We’ll look to you to deliver proactive plans to ensure efficient and effective delivery of TPRM processes in line with our objectives, KPIS and customer requirements. You’ll identify and support the development and simplification of processes and procedures that will enhance our proposition aligned with the framework and relevant legal or regulatory requirements to enable the franchise and functions to better manage their risk.

You’ll also:

  • Deliver proactive plans to ensure efficient delivery and management of risk and supply chain processes align with our customer’s needs, the service level agreements and to the required quality
  • Negotiate regulatory driven contractual change with suppliers, undertaking contract and financial signing authority in line with published delegated levels of authority and regional variations
  • Build and maintain strong relationships across TPRM, franchise and functions, 3 lines of defence and Supply Chain and be recognised for delivering excellent service
  • Support effective reporting that can be utilised by the franchise and functions and accountable executives to identify, manage and remediate their external outsourcing (EO) risks
  • Manage queries, where applicable, achieving strong Voice of the Customer feedback and adhering to Service Level Agreements
The skills you'll need

We’re on the lookout for someone with excellent stakeholder management skills, experience of collaborating and influencing others and an understanding of the latest industry TPRM and functional developments and trends.

You’ll also need:

  • A proven track record in taking ownership for resolving issues with Third Parties
  • Experience of managing simplification including automation or AI
  • The ability to work on your own initiative, be part of a team and encourage and motivate others
  • Experience or understanding of legal and contract law relevant to supply chain

What you need to know about the Chennai Tech Scene

To locals, it's no secret that South India is leading the charge in big data infrastructure. While the environmental impact of data centers has long been a concern, emerging hubs like Chennai are favored by companies seeking ready access to renewable energy resources, which provide more sustainable and cost-effective solutions. As a result, Chennai, along with neighboring Bengaluru and Hyderabad, is poised for significant growth, with a projected 65 percent increase in data center capacity over the next decade.
